Output 0d4f6eecbb0d6bacf7220065c1776676eb781c2b4750256b9e942f7b777450f2:0

value
76626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23d0525c916e5040cf23dfbe2beb58624b0af93a OP_EQUAL
address
34xP8hqxJNf3Jb4HvkBk91wb9M7ZJmtVda
transaction
0d4f6eecbb0d6bacf7220065c1776676eb781c2b4750256b9e942f7b777450f2
confirmations
98831
spent
true